NAVIGATION (CONSTRUCTION) REGULATIONS 1968 - REG 20

Damage control plans

(1)
The master or owner of a ship may take the ship to sea, or permit the ship to be taken to sea, only if:

(a)
there are permanently exhibited in the wheelhouse or charthouse plans showing clearly, for each deck and hold, the boundaries of the watertight compartments, the openings in those compartments, the means of closure and the position of any controls of those means of closure and the arrangements for the correction of any list due to flooding; and

(b)
there are on board, in booklet form, a number at least equal to the number of officers normally carried in the ship of copies of the information referred to in paragraph (a).

Penalty:   2 penalty units.

(2)
An offence against subregulation (1) is an offence of strict liability.

Note    For strict liability , see section 6.1 of the Criminal Code .
